In the competitive world of startups, attracting the attention of investors and venture capitalists is crucial. One of the key tools that startups use to pitch their ideas is the pitch deck – a brief presentation that provides an overview of your business. But with countless startups vying for attention, how can you ensure your pitch deck stands out from the crowd? The secret lies in storytelling, design, and data visualization. Here are some tips to make your pitch deck unique and memorable.
1. Tell a Compelling Story
The first step in crafting a unique pitch deck is to tell a compelling story. Your pitch deck should be more than just a collection of facts and figures. It should tell a story that captivates your audience and makes them want to know more. Begin with a problem that your target audience can relate to, and then introduce your solution in a way that resonates with them. Show how your product or service can make a real impact. Use anecdotes and examples to bring your story to life. Remember, investors are more likely to remember and connect with a story than a list of features.
2. How can you ensure your pitch deck stands out from the crowd? Keep It Simple
When it comes to pitch deck design, simplicity is key. Don’t overwhelm your audience with too much information or too many visuals. Keep your slides clean and easy to read. Use a consistent color scheme and font throughout the presentation. Focus on the most important information and present it in a way that is easy to understand. Avoid using jargon or technical terms that may confuse your audience. Instead, use simple language that anyone can understand.
3. Use Data Visualization
Data visualization is a powerful tool that can help you make your pitch deck stand out. Instead of presenting data in tables or text, use charts and graphs to visualize the information. This makes it easier for your audience to understand and remember the data. Choose the right type of chart or graph for your data, and use colors and labels to make it easy to read. Make sure your data visualization is accurate and supports your story.
4. Focus on the Benefits to make your pitch deck stands out
When presenting your product or service, focus on the benefits rather than the features. Investors want to know how your product or service will make a difference in the market. Show how your product or service can solve a problem or meet a need. Use examples and testimonials to demonstrate the value of your offering. Highlight any competitive advantages that set your product or service apart from the competition.
5. End with a Strong Call-to-Action
Your pitch deck should end with a strong call-to-action that prompts your audience to take the next step. Whether you want them to schedule a follow-up meeting, sign up for a demo, or invest in your company, make it clear what you want them to do. Use persuasive language and make it easy for them to take action.
In conclusion, making your pitch deck stand out in the crowded startup ecosystem requires a combination of storytelling, design, and data visualization. By telling a compelling story, keeping your design simple, using data visualization, focusing on the benefits, and ending with a strong call-to-action, you can create a unique and memorable pitch deck that captures the attention of investors and venture capitalists.
